Management buyout at Windsor

.

Healthcare Recruitment and Training Specialists, Windsor Recruitment and Windsor Training, has today announced a Management Buy-Out of the company in a deal designed to enable the business to continue to build on its existing growth and become a major healthcare recruitment and training provider in the UK.

The company will continue to be led by existing Managing Director, Alex OíNeill and as part of the transaction they will be joined internally by Derek Kitchen as their new Finance Director.

Alex Oí Neill now significant shareholder following the Management Buy-Out started his career with Windsor back in April 1998 as a recruitment consultant. His role within the company was to establish and develop a new healthcare division for what was then a purely commercial and industrial temp agency. He got his first temps out in week one (46 hours!) and proceeded to build the business. Within his first year he went on a ëtourí of the country and at the end of year Windsor was operating out of 3 branches these being Birmingham, Brighton and Liverpool. By the end of year 2 they also had branches in Bristol, Leeds, and Coventry. And the rest is history as they say.

As of Dec 2006 Windsor now have branches and training centres in major cities across the UK and with annual sales topping 11 million, an increase of 18% so far this year. We are very committed to furthering the growth of these businesses and plan to add to the existing range of products and services within recruitment, franchising and training said Alex OíNeill.

Trevor Heathfield the Founder of Windsor said, Iím absolutely delighted with the outcome of this deal I could not leave the business in better hands. Trevor will remain a shareholder and very much look forward to working with Alex and Derek in the next phase of Windsorís success story.

The management buy-out comes at a time when Finance Director, Paul Bradford retires. Paul has been with Windsor for the past sixteen years and is now handing over to Derek Kitchen, Operations at Windsor.
Derek Kitchen who has over seventeen years NHS experience, started his career working in finance within the public and private sector before joining the NHS. Having worked at Northern Birmingham Mental Health Trust as Finance Director for six years, Derek then went on to work as Chief Executive for a further three years.

Following his success in his previous position, Derek is delighted in his new role as Finance Director he comments ìI am really excited with the opportunity to contribute to the continued quality and growth of Windsor Recruitment and Windsor Trainingî.
